National History Challenge winners

Angus Christie and Jack Carr, National History Challenge winners (large)

On Monday 9 November Angus Christie and Jack Carr attended the National History Challenge presentation ceremony at the Premiers Function room, hosted by The Honourable Elise Archer.

Not only did the boys win the State Award and the National Award for their amazing investigation into the Kokoda Track, they were also awarded the Premiers Award, the top award in Tasmania, in recognition of their efforts.

Jack and Angus produced an interactive book which includes an interview with 98 year old Penguin Kokoda veteran Ted Howell.
